"Yellow bell pepper and vanilla vodka just sounded good together one day."Plus: Ultimate Cocktail Guide By Ryan Magarian Updated on June 30, 2021 Print Rate It Share Share Tweet Pin Email Yield: 1 drink Ingredients One 2-inch grapefruit wedge Two 3-by-1/2-inch strips of yellow bell pepper, plus 1 thin strip for garnish 2 large basil sprigs 1 1/2 ounces vanilla vodka 1 ounce Simple Syrup 1/2 ounce fresh lemon juice 1/2 ounce fresh lime juice Ice Directions In a cocktail shaker, muddle the grapefruit with the yellow pepper strips. Tear and bruise the basil sprigs. Add the basil, vodka, Simple Syrup and citrus juices to the shaker, fill with ice and shake vigorously. Strain into a chilled martini glass and garnish with the thin yellow pepper strip. Rate it Print
